Skills and Competencies- Extensive experience (8+ years) building and shipping production-grade software systems or services, including distributed systems and large-scale data processing; 10+ years and Engineering Manager/Technical Lead experience preferred.
- Proven ability to design, build, and operate online services and fault-tolerant distributed systems at internet scale, including cloud service development (Azure or AWS).
- Demonstrable proficiency in C++/C#/Java, REST APIs, agile and test-driven development, and secure software design concepts.
- Hands-on experience with artificial intelligence concepts and tools to streamline engineering workflows and address complex business challenges; awareness of AI risk management and ethical use.
- Strong problem-solving, debugging, and data-driven iterative improvement skills; familiarity with microservices, DevSecOps, and cloud-scale distributed design patterns.
- Experience building and scaling full-stack engineering teams across geographies, architecting and delivering distributed cloud services, and working with modern infrastructure tools (e.g., Docker, Kubernetes, Terraform, GitHub Actions, Jenkins, Azure DevOps, Datadog, Prometheus, Grafana, ELK stack) preferred.
- BS/MS/PhD in Computer Science or equivalent industry experience.

The Team: Our Platform Engineering team is responsible for building and maintaining the foundational systems and services that power Moody’s technology ecosystem. We enable innovation by providing scalable, reliable, and secure platforms that support the development and deployment of cutting‑edge applications. By joining our team, you will be part of exciting work in cloud infrastructure, DevOps, and AI‑driven platform solution.
